What Is Cold Laser Treatment?



Cold laser therapy, likewise called low-level laser treatment (LLLT), is a non-invasive treatment that uses particular wavelengths of light to advertise healing and decrease pain.

This cutting-edge approach targets damaged cells, promoting mobile activity without causing injury or discomfort. You may find it advantageous for different conditions, consisting of joint pain, muscle injuries, and inflammation.

Unlike standard laser treatments, cold laser treatment does not produce heat, making it safe and comfy for clients. Treatments commonly last in between 5 to 30 minutes, depending upon the area being addressed.

You may get several sessions for optimal outcomes, and lots of people report feeling alleviation after simply a few treatments.

Cold laser therapy uses a promising option for those seeking efficient discomfort management.

System of Activity



Laser therapy employs low-level lasers or light-emitting diodes to stimulate mobile procedures. When you obtain therapy, the light permeates your skin and is taken in by your cells, particularly the mitochondria. This absorption boosts ATP manufacturing, which is the energy money of your cells. Therefore, your cells can repair themselves faster and successfully.

Furthermore, cold laser therapy advertises raised blood circulation, supplying even more oxygen and nutrients to broken tissues. It likewise helps in reducing swelling and pain by modulating the launch of different biochemical compounds.

Treatment Refine Summary



When you undergo cold laser therapy, a qualified expert guides low-level laser light onto the targeted location of your body. This non-invasive procedure generally lasts in between 15 to half an hour, depending upon your problem and the location being treated. You may feel a gentle heat or tingling feeling, but the procedure is usually painless.


The laser light penetrates your skin, promoting cellular task and advertising healing. Sessions are typically scheduled multiple times a week for optimum outcomes, and you might discover improvements after just a few therapies.

After each session, you can normally resume your day-to-day tasks with no downtime, making it a convenient option for those looking for relief from pain or inflammation.

Security and Negative Effects of Cold Laser Therapy



While cold laser treatment is generally thought about secure, it's vital to know possible negative effects. Lots of people experience minimal discomfort, however you may see momentary skin irritability or a feeling of heat throughout therapy.

Rarely, some people report frustrations or lightheadedness after sessions. If you're sensitive to light or have specific clinical problems, discuss this with your healthcare provider prior to beginning therapy.

Additionally, guarantee the practitioner is qualified and utilizes FDA-approved tools. Although severe side effects are unusual, it's wise to monitor your body's reaction after each session.

If you experience any type of unusual signs and symptoms, do not wait to reach out to your medical professional for guidance. Being educated aids guarantee a positive experience with cold laser therapy.
